    Alison H.

    Yummmm! I finally checked this place out and I'm in love. The flavors are so unique and the tea taste is so present. The ambience reminds me a lot of Taiwan. We ordered the peanut butter coffee and banana milk tea (half sweet) with boba. Both had distinct, delicious flavors. The banana milk tea wasn't cloyingly sweet and reminded me of candy I had when I was younger. I think we should've gotten the peanut butter coffee half sweet, but it was still wonderful. The boba was also super good; it was chewy even in cold drinks! Price is a little up there, but well worth it for quality boba at a family owned place. Great service and drinks. Will definitely be back to try more flavors and toppings!!!

    V L.

    This charming, family owned boba shop deserves a spot on the map! They are from Taiwan-the birthplace of boba, and take immense pride in what they do. This becomes apparent in the care they take in crafting your beverage and the no gimmick way their shop is set up. It's no frills, just an authentic boba experience from two very sweet and extremely welcoming ladies. I ordered the original milk tea and taro milk tea at 100% sweetness and both were top contenders for best in the area compared to the likes of franchise places such as T4, Kung Fu Tea, Sharetea...etc. The tea flavor is perfectly robust without being overbearing. It complements well with the milk and sweetness. While 100% sweetness may be a tad too much for my personal liking, it is customizable so you can adjust accordingly. Fun fact: there's a picture of their original shop in Taiwan's Huaxi Street Night Market posted at the entrance...you really can't get more authentic than this!
